Defect summary | Porsche cars north america, inc. (porsche) is recalling certain 2010-2016 panamera 4s and panamera s, 2011-2016 panamera, panamera 4 and panamera turbo, 2012-2016 panamera turbo s and panamera s e-hybrid, 2013-2016 panamera gts, 2013 panamera platinum edition and panamera 4 platinum edition, 2014-2016 panamera 4s executive, panamera turbo executive and panamera turbo s executive, 2015 panamera diesel and 2016 panamera 4 edition, panamera edition and panamera turbo s exclusive series vehicles. Water may enter the a/c blower control unit, causing an electrical short circuit. |
Consequence summary | An electrical short increases the risk of fire. |
Corrective action | Porsche will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the blower control unit, replacing it as necessary, free of charge. The recall began february 10, 2020. Owners may contact porsche customer service at 1-800-767-7243. Porsche's number for this recall is aka7. Note: porsche recommends that owners park their vehicle outdoors until the recall remedy has been performed. |
